Understanding the Square Wave vs Sine Wave Inverter Choice in Padrauna
The core difference between these two technologies lies in the waveform output they produce. A square wave alternative delivers power in sudden, blocky transitions, whereas a sine wave model mimics the smooth, continuous flow of grid electricity. While older, simpler appliances can tolerate rougher wave inputs, modern electronic devices require a clean power delivery to function efficiently without internal stress.
Performance Side-by-Side
When compared directly under actual operating conditions, the performance gap between the two waveforms becomes obvious:
- Appliance Humming: Square wave systems often cause a noticeable buzzing sound in ceiling fans and fluorescent lights, whereas sine wave systems run completely silent.
- Device Safety: Sensitive electronics like laptops, routers, and smart TVs can overheat or malfunction on a square wave, while a sine wave alternative ensures smooth, safe operation.
- Switchover Speed: Standard wave inverters can have slow transition times, causing computers to reboot during a PuVVNL outage.
Lifespan and Durability in Composite Climates
Padrauna's Composite climate zone experiences intense summer heat, placing extra thermal stress on power backup hardware. A square wave inverter produces more harmonic distortion, which translates into excess heat within both the inverter and the connected appliances. Over time, this heat degrades internal components faster. Conversely, a high-quality sine wave alternative runs cooler and preserves the operational life of your expensive home appliances.
